The Significance of Personal Data Privacy in Today’s Digital Age

In today’s interconnected world, where personal data is constantly being collected, stored, and shared, the significance of personal data privacy cannot be overstated. Individuals are sharing more information about themselves online than ever before, making it crucial to understand the importance of data privacy as a fundamental personal right in today’s digital age.

Here are some key points that highlight the significance of personal data privacy:

  • Protection of Personal Information: Personal data includes information such as names, addresses, phone numbers, financial details, and even browsing history. Ensuring the privacy of this data is essential to prevent identity theft, fraud, and other forms of misuse.
  • Individual Autonomy: Respecting an individual’s right to control their personal information empowers them to make informed choices about what they share and with whom. This autonomy is essential for maintaining personal freedom and independence.
  • Trust and Security: When individuals trust that their data is being handled responsibly and securely, it enhances their confidence in online interactions. Building trust through strong data privacy practices is crucial for fostering healthy relationships between individuals and organizations.
  • Legal Protections: Various laws and regulations,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in the European Union and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) in the United States, aim to protect individuals’ privacy rights and hold organizations accountable for how they handle personal data.
  • Business Ethics: Respecting personal data privacy is not just a legal requirement but also an ethical responsibility for businesses. Prioritizing data privacy can help build a positive reputation, enhance customer loyalty, and differentiate a business in the competitive marketplace.

By recognizing the significance of personal data privacy in today’s digital age, individuals can take proactive steps to safeguard their information, advocate for stronger privacy protections, and make informed decisions about how their data is used and shared. The Significance of Privacy in Modern Society: Understanding its Importance and Impact

The Importance of Data Privacy as a Personal Right in Today’s World

Data privacy is a fundamental concept that has become increasingly important in modern society. As technology continues to advance, the collection and sharing of personal data have raised concerns about individual privacy rights. Understanding the significance of privacy in today’s world is crucial for individuals to protect their personal information and maintain control over their data.

Key Points:

  • Protecting Personal Information: Data privacy refers to the protective measures taken to safeguard an individual’s personal information from unauthorized access or use. This includes sensitive data such as financial records, medical history, and online activities.
  • Legal Framework: In the United States, data privacy is governed by a combination of federal and state laws, as well as industry regulations. The main federal law addressing data privacy is the Privacy Act of 1974, which regulates the collection, use, and disclosure of personal information by federal agencies.
  • Impact on Individuals: Data privacy is essential for maintaining autonomy and control over one’s personal information. Without adequate privacy protections, individuals may be at risk of identity theft, fraud, or unauthorized surveillance.
  • Corporate Responsibility: Companies that collect and store personal data have a responsibility to implement robust data privacy measures to protect their customers’ information. Failure to do so can result in data breaches, legal liabilities, and damage to reputation.
  • Evolving Landscape: The digital landscape is constantly evolving, with new technologies and data collection practices emerging regularly. It is essential for individuals to stay informed about their privacy rights and take proactive steps to safeguard their personal information.
